Physics Beyond Standard Model in Neutron Beta Decay
Jacek Holeczek🇵🇱 · Michal Ochman🇵🇱 · Elzbieta Stephan🇵🇱 · Marek Zralek🇵🇱
Abstract
Limits from neutron beta decay on parameters describing physics beyond the Standard Model are presented. New Physics is described by the most general Lorentz invariant effective Hamiltonian involving vector, scalar and tensor operators and Standard Model fields only. Two-parameter fits to the decay parameters measured in free neutron beta decay have been done, in some cases indicating rather big dependence of the results on g_A/g_V ratio of nucleon form factors at zero four-momentum transfer.
